WRITE A LETTER

Hand-Deliver It

Expressing gratitude is a skill that can be developed and honed with habitual practice. When you want to share your feelings of appreciation to someone for something he or she has done for you, write that person a letter. Words are meaningful but words on a page are so much more lasting. The receiver can take the letter out again and again to read it and feel lifted by your heartfelt words. Maybe you’re someone who just isn’t comfortable gushing to others about how much you appreciate what they’ve done for you. When you take the time to sit down and write a letter, you can focus on language and tone and style for how you want to convey your gratitude.

Use the letter method to thank a friend for bringing you chicken soup when you were sick or for sharing bounty from her backyard or letting you use an empty shed on his property for storage. A handwritten letter is much more personal than a typewritten one for the purposes of offering a thank-you. Designate a special pen for these purposes.

• Set out paper and take your pen in hand.

• Close your eyes and breathe deeply for three cycles.

• Gather your thoughts around your friend’s selfless act.

• Feel gratitude rising and write from that energy.
